  • Page 12 Addendum - Continued Fuses - Checking / Replacing There are two fuses located in the control box. They are spring loaded in a barrel housing. To remove, push down and turn counter-clockwise to release. Remove cap to check or re- place fuse.

  • Page 16 Addendum - Continued Troubleshooting Guide Condition Check - Door will not open or close. - Check remote battery (battery is good if tip lights red when buttons pressed). - Check outlet where control unit is plugged in for power. - Open control box and check if power light is on. See page 14. - Check fuses.
